hey guys I'm an experienced mechanic, but this car has got me stumped.

06 350z - Came to my shop as a no start diagnosis. Here is what I have done so far, any help is really appreciated !


Car cranks over strongly but won't start, and hardly even hiccups, doesn't want to start. When you put the gas pedal all the way down it seems like it hiccups a bit, trying to start ever so slightly.

I pulled all the wires, checking for spark at each one, wires have spark, and are in the correct order.

Pulled plugs and replaced with new

Fuel pump can be heard priming.

Sprayed starting fluid down into the intake via the throttle body, and also directly into the spark plug wells when I changed the plugs, no change at all.

Battery is good and charged

No check engine codes, and no security light. Trouble lights come on normally when you turn the key to power, then go off.


Really stumped here. Figured since I can see spark, it must be fuel/air, but no reaction to the starting fluid.


Anybody have any ideas?

When I need to have my car towed by AAA when I move, I unplug the ecm. The car will attempt to start, but will never start, so I get the tow. It tries to crank over so the tow driver won't try to jump the battery.

So maybe an issue with communications to the ecm. Check the ipdm and it's relays. I also fried my ecm once, took a heck of a while to diagnose, but the car would try to crank over but never would.
